Mass Communication Colleges Focus On Offering Varied Experiences

The field of mass communication serves as the connection between people and various events and occurrences that take place around them. It involves the study of mass media which consists of electronic and print media primarily. Considering the important role played by the media in people’s everyday lives and decision making processes, the study of mass communication is indeed a very important one. In fact, people with degrees from good mass communication colleges go on to build very satisfying careers in journalism, public relations, advertising, television, movies and academia and even in politics.
The best mass communication colleges offer students varied experiences in order to ensure that they are well equipped to do justice to their jobs. As a matter of fact, employers such as media houses and advertising companies tend to select candidates who graduate from colleges that offer them the widest range of experiences that will help them perform their work properly.
The quality of faculty and curriculum is indeed very important towards ensuring that students ...
... get the best possible training. College faculty should ideally have lots of work experience in the industry so that they will be able to provide proper guidance to students. The best colleges have highly respected faculty members who are able to motivate and guide students to do well at their studies and eventually jobs.
Practical knowledge is very important in this field. Therefore, mass communication colleges have to be equipped with the right kind of infrastructure and equipment. They have labs as well as cameras, lights and the like. Colleges also have tie ups with media organizations in order to provide students with exposure to various areas of work. In addition, students are encouraged to produce documentaries, magazines, journals and even blogs in order to hone their skills. Many colleges also organize events and training programs with government bodies.
The number of companies that recruit from colleges depends on the amount of practical exposure that it is able to provide its students. There is an explosion in the number of media houses in India and these companies choose to hire people who come from institutes that offer a well-rounded education. It is best to find out which is one of the best mass communication colleges available before applying to study there. Course fees can be quite expensive but the employment prospects are very good as a result of which many students queue up for these courses.
